Transaction 07a3c76d3f403151723337d3a5895935e06ce4b867bdc763bc1df8e190839501
1 Input
2 Outputs
- 07a3c76d3f403151723337d3a5895935e06ce4b867bdc763bc1df8e190839501:0
- 07a3c76d3f403151723337d3a5895935e06ce4b867bdc763bc1df8e190839501:1
value 5295964
address 12st5eSSWxp1VBG8yjQvTCK5mhrWGzg2Ha
value 267946
address 1PYWW2u6rdhhmhxgwLDQHNxiXV6fKrdwFS